Question 1: What is a key characteristic of a self-organizing agile team?
- Team members wait for a manager to assign tasks
- The team decides how best to accomplish their work without being directed by others (Correct answer)
- Only the Scrum Master assigns tasks
- The Product Owner directs all daily work
Correct answer: The team decides how best to accomplish their work without being directed by others
Self-organizing teams determine internally how to accomplish their goals rather than being externally directed by a manager.
Question 2: Which agile practice helps teams identify and remove impediments quickly?
- Sprint review
- Daily standup (Correct answer)
- Sprint planning
- Backlog refinement
Correct answer: Daily standup
The daily standup is a short synchronization meeting where team members surface blockers for rapid resolution.
Question 3: What do 'T-shaped skills' mean in an agile team context?
- A team member only knows one skill
- A team member has deep expertise in one area and broad knowledge across other disciplines (Correct answer)
- All team members have identical skill sets
- Team members specialize in exactly two areas
Correct answer: A team member has deep expertise in one area and broad knowledge across other disciplines
T-shaped skills refer to having depth in one specialty combined with breadth across multiple disciplines, enabling cross-functional collaboration.
Question 4: What is the recommended agile team size according to most agile frameworks?
- 2-3 members
- 5-9 members (Correct answer)
- 15-20 members
- 25 or more members
Correct answer: 5-9 members
Most agile frameworks recommend teams of 5-9 members to balance communication efficiency with diverse skill coverage.
Question 5: What is 'swarming' in agile team dynamics?
- Team members ignoring their assignments
- Multiple team members collaborating on a single task to complete it faster (Correct answer)
- Assigning one person to handle all bugs
- Breaking work into the smallest possible pieces
Correct answer: Multiple team members collaborating on a single task to complete it faster
Swarming occurs when team members collectively focus on one work item to remove blockers and accelerate its completion.
Question 6: What agile concept describes the team's shared responsibility for delivering quality work?
- Individual accountability
- Manager oversight
- Collective ownership (Correct answer)
- Specialist handoffs
Correct answer: Collective ownership
Collective ownership means the entire team is responsible for the quality and delivery of all work items, not just individual contributors.
